Easy Grilled Shrimp with Corn Salsa

This simple yet vibrant dish combines tender grilled shrimp with a refreshing corn salsa, perfect for summer gatherings.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Course Dinner, Grilling, Main Course
Cuisine American, Seafood
Servings 6 servings
Calories 300 kcal

Ingredients
  

For the Corn Salsa

  • 2 large ears sweet corn, husked
  • 1 small red onion, diced into 1/4-inch pieces
  • 2 limes, juiced
  • 1 jalapeno, seeds removed and finely minced
  • 2 plum tomatoes, diced
  • 1/2 bunch fresh cilantro, chopped
  • 1 1/4 tsp Morton Kosher salt

For the Shrimp

  • 2 lb jumbo shrimp, peeled and deveined with tails on
  • 1 1/2 tbsp Bertolli Extra Virgin olive oil
  • 3/4 tsp kosher salt
  • 1/2 tsp freshly ground black pepper
  • 2 tsp McCormick Dark Chili Powder
  • 1/2 tsp onion powder
  • 1/2 tsp garlic powder
  • 1/2 tsp ground cumin
  • 1/2 tsp smoked paprika

For Serving

  • 2 limes, cut into wedges
  • 1/4 cup fresh cilantro leaves

Instructions
 

Preparation

  • Start by placing your husked ears of corn on the grill over medium heat. Grill them for about 8-10 minutes, turning occasionally until they are charred and tender.
  • While the corn is grilling, dice your red onion, jalapeno, and tomatoes.
  • Once the corn is cooled a bit, cut the kernels off the cob into a large bowl. Add your chopped red onion, jalapeno, tomatoes, cilantro, lime juice, and Kosher salt. Toss everything together.
  • In another bowl, combine olive oil, black pepper, dark chili powder, onion powder, garlic powder, ground cumin, and smoked paprika. Add the shrimp and toss until they are well coated with the spice mixture.
  • Preheat the grill to medium-high heat. Thread the shrimp onto skewers or place them directly on the grill. Grill them for about 2-3 minutes on each side until they are pink and opaque.
  • Once the shrimp is done, transfer everything to a large platter. Serve the shrimp alongside the corn salsa with lime wedges.

Notes

This dish can be stored in airtight containers in the fridge. The flavors will deepen overnight. Reheat gently on the stovetop or in the microwave. Shrimp can be varied with seasonal vegetables for added texture.
